Dr Quoc Duong

General Practitioner MBBS, FRACGP

Dr Quoc Duong is as an experienced family practitioner. Dr Quoc enjoys all aspects of general practice with a special interest in Preventative Health, Travel Medicine, Sports Injuries, General Dermatology and Minor Surgical Procedures.

Dr Quoc studied medicine at Melbourne University and graduated in 1996. Quoc spent 5 years in gaining experience in surgery and almost a decade in emergency before moving into General Practice. He enjoys spending time with his young family and relaxes by playing the guitar and listening to music.

Dr Roshini Tennakoon

General Practitioner MBBS

Dr Roshini is a GP Registrar who graduated from Monash University. She has broad hospital experience, having completed a physician training year across a range of specialties including geriatrics, endocrinology, haematology, and paediatrics, as well as a full year working in emergency medicine.

Her time in emergency medicine helped her develop strong skills in managing acute illness and performing a variety of procedures, which she now brings into her work as a GP. Dr Roshini enjoys taking a holistic, patient-centred approach to care and values getting to know her patients and supporting them through all stages of health and wellbeing.

Outside of work, Dr Roshini loves cooking, playing badminton, and spending time outdoors. She and her husband enjoy hiking with their dog, Nemo, a Rhodesian Ridgeback, and exploring new trails and scenery together.

Dr Roshini speaks English and Sinhalese.

Dr Shruti Kotecha

General Practitioner, BBiomedSc MD SCHP FRACGP

Dr Shruti worked with us as a GP registrar in 2022 and now returns back as a Fellow. She obtained her medical degree from Melbourne University in 2018. She worked for three years as a hospital doctor gaining valuable experience in many areas including emergency medicine and women’s health before moving into general practice. She enjoys all facets of general practice but has a particular passion for children’s health, having spent part of her training at The Royal Children’s Hospital Melbourne. She has also completed the Sydney Child Health Program. Outside of work Shruti enjoys painting, travelling and spending time with friends & family.

Dr Monisha Koppaka

General Practitioner MBBS, SCHP, FRACGP

Dr Monisha is a friendly and relatable doctor with experience in all aspects of family medicine. She has has a particular interest in dermatology as well as women's and children's health. She also holds a diploma in child health.

Dr Maathanghi Kumariah

General Practitioner MBBS, FRACGP

Dr Kumariah studied at Monash University and trained across Eastern and Peninsula Health where she gained experience in paediatrics, general medicine and emergency medicine. She has an interest in all aspects of general practice and is developing a special interest in preventative medicine, women's health and mental health.
